THE SCHIFF-CZ DEBATE: WHY BITCOIN CREATES REAL WEALTH - AND GOLD BUG LOGIC IS FLAWED

A debate between gold advocate Peter Schiff and CZ (Changpeng Zhao) highlighted the fundamental, irreconcilable split over Bitcoin’s value, with Schiff arguing the digital asset is a “zero-sum wealth transfer” that creates no real economic wealth. However, an analysis of Schiff’s claims exposes a core logical flaw: the refusal to acknowledge that value in the modern economy is generated by utility and consensus, not just physical substance. I. The Zero-Sum Fallacy: Wealth is More Than Gold Schiff’s central claim was that Bitcoin merely “enables a transfer of wealth from people who buy BTC to the people who sell it,” arguing that the creation of 20 million Bitcoin has not made the world “better off.” The Flaw: This argument fails to account for utility as a form of wealth creation. By this logic, software, internet domain names, cloud infrastructure, and even government-issued fiat currency would all be worthless, as they are non-physical creations of consensus.The Counterargument: Bitcoin, by contrast, generates real economic function: it powers censorship-resistant storage, enables instant, borderless cross-border settlement without intermediaries, and serves as secure financial collateral. A global monetary network that moves value like data a capability that did not exist before Bitcoin is wealth creation by definition. II. The Collapse Projection: Betting Against Adoption Schiff claimed that Bitcoin investors are simply under a delusion of wealth that will be shattered when they try to “get out,” resting his thesis on the core assumption that Bitcoin is destined for a market collapse. The Flaw: This view equates unrealized gains with illusions, ignoring the simple fact that wealth is realized when an asset is eventually sold at a higher price. More importantly, it ignores overwhelming institutional momentum.The Reality: The consistent growth in demand from major players including institutional ETFs, corporate treasuries, and sovereign funds moving toward digital asset custody actively undercuts Schiff’s prediction. The fact that Bitcoin underpins multi-billion-dollar remittance rails and a growing payments infrastructure suggests it is functioning far beyond a mere speculative bubble, strengthening its long-term existence as a monetary network. III. Final Verdict: The Battle for a New Standard Peter Schiff’s position relies on an outdated, physical-centric view of economic value. Bitcoin’s unique attributes it is a mathematically verifiable, bearer asset that settles without friction are features that no traditional asset class, not even gold, can replicate. The debate ultimately confirms that Bitcoin’s value proposition does not depend on a physical form, but on its enduring global consensus and the utility of the powerful, borderless monetary network it has created.
